Identify Your Strengths: What are you good at? Seriously, make a list! It can be anything from baking amazing cookies to being a fantastic listener. Focusing on your strengths helps you recognize your value and build a positive self-image. When you acknowledge and appreciate your talents and abilities, you naturally feel more confident in your capacity to succeed. Furthermore, understanding your strengths allows you to leverage them in various aspects of your life, whether it's at work, in your relationships, or in your hobbies. This can lead to greater achievements and a stronger sense of self-efficacy.
-
Set Achievable Goals: Don't try to climb Mount Everest on your first hike! Start small and set goals that you can actually achieve. Each time you reach a goal, you'll get a little boost of confidence. Setting realistic goals helps you break down larger objectives into manageable steps, making the overall process less daunting and more achievable. As you accomplish each milestone, you gain momentum and confidence in your ability to tackle more significant challenges. This sense of progress and accomplishment is crucial for building self-esteem and maintaining motivation. Moreover, achievable goals provide a sense of direction and purpose, helping you stay focused and committed to your personal and professional development.

Practice Positive Self-Talk: That little voice in your head? Make sure it's saying nice things! Instead of focusing on your flaws, tell yourself things like, "I'm capable," "I'm learning," and "I can handle this." Positive self-talk is a powerful tool for reshaping your mindset and building a more positive self-image. By replacing negative thoughts with affirming statements, you can gradually reprogram your subconscious mind to believe in your abilities and potential. This can lead to increased self-confidence, reduced anxiety, and a more optimistic outlook on life. Furthermore, positive self-talk helps you develop resilience in the face of adversity, enabling you to bounce back from setbacks and challenges with greater ease and determination. It also fosters a sense of self-compassion, allowing you to treat yourself with kindness and understanding, even when you make mistakes or fall short of your goals.
-
Face Your Fears: Okay, this one can be tough, but it's so worth it! What are you afraid of? Public speaking? Talking to new people? Start small and gradually push yourself outside your comfort zone. Each time you face a fear, you'll prove to yourself that you're stronger than you thought. Facing your fears is a transformative process that can significantly boost your self-confidence and empower you to live a more fulfilling life. By confronting the things that scare you, you challenge your limiting beliefs and prove to yourself that you are capable of overcoming obstacles. This can lead to a greater sense of self-efficacy, increased resilience, and a willingness to take on new challenges. Furthermore, facing your fears helps you expand your comfort zone, opening up new opportunities for personal and professional growth. It also allows you to develop valuable coping skills and strategies for managing anxiety and stress. Remember, it's okay to start small and gradually work your way up to larger challenges. The key is to consistently push yourself outside your comfort zone and celebrate your progress along the way.
-
Celebrate Your Wins: Did you ace that presentation? Did you finally finish that project you've been putting off? Celebrate it! Acknowledge your accomplishments, no matter how small, and give yourself credit for your hard work. Celebrating your wins is an essential part of building self-confidence and maintaining motivation. By acknowledging and appreciating your accomplishments, you reinforce positive behaviors and create a sense of momentum that propels you forward. This can lead to increased self-esteem, reduced self-doubt, and a greater willingness to take on new challenges. Furthermore, celebrating your wins helps you develop a more positive self-image and fosters a sense of gratitude for your abilities and opportunities. It also allows you to savor your successes and enjoy the journey of personal and professional growth. Remember to celebrate even the small victories, as they all contribute to your overall progress and well-being. Treat yourself to something special, share your achievements with others, or simply take a moment to reflect on your accomplishments and feel proud of what you have achieved.
-
Take Care of Yourself: This one is super important! Make sure you're eating healthy, getting enough sleep, and exercising regularly. When you feel good physically, you're more likely to feel good mentally and emotionally. Taking care of yourself is fundamental to building self-confidence and maintaining overall well-being. When you prioritize your physical and mental health, you are better equipped to handle stress, manage challenges, and achieve your goals. This can lead to increased self-esteem, reduced anxiety, and a more positive outlook on life. Furthermore, taking care of yourself demonstrates self-respect and self-compassion, fostering a sense of inner peace and contentment. Make sure to incorporate healthy habits into your daily routine, such as eating nutritious foods, getting enough sleep, exercising regularly, and practicing mindfulness or meditation. These practices will not only improve your physical health but also enhance your mental and emotional well-being, allowing you to feel more confident, energized, and resilient.

What Exactly is Self-Confidence?
Okay, so what is self-confidence, really? It's that quiet, internal belief in your own abilities, qualities, and judgment. It’s not about being arrogant or thinking you’re perfect. Nope, it's more about accepting yourself—flaws and all—and trusting that you can handle whatever life throws your way. Think of it as having your own personal cheerleader inside your head, always rooting for you, even when you stumble. When you are self-confident, you approach challenges with a positive attitude, believing in your capacity to learn and grow. This belief, in turn, influences your actions, making you more likely to take risks and step outside your comfort zone. It's not about having all the answers or never making mistakes; rather, it's about trusting that you can figure things out, learn from your errors, and keep moving forward. Self-confidence also affects how you interact with others. When you feel good about yourself, you naturally exude a sense of assurance that can be attractive and inspiring to those around you. This can lead to better relationships, improved communication, and greater influence in both personal and professional settings. Furthermore, self-confidence is not a static trait. It's something that can be developed and strengthened over time through practice, self-awareness, and positive self-talk. By recognizing your strengths, acknowledging your weaknesses, and celebrating your achievements, you can gradually build a stronger sense of self-belief. This journey of self-discovery and personal growth is a continuous process, but the rewards of increased self-confidence are immeasurable, touching every aspect of your life and empowering you to live more fully and authentically. Remember, self-confidence isn't about never doubting yourself; it's about knowing that even when you do, you have the inner strength to overcome those doubts and keep striving towards your goals.
Why is Self-Confidence Important?
Alright, so why should you even care about self-confidence? Well, let me tell you, it's a game-changer! Think about it: when you believe in yourself, you're way more likely to chase after your dreams. You're not held back by that nagging voice of doubt saying, "You can't do it!" Instead, you're like, "Heck yeah, I can! Let's do this!" Self-confidence fuels your motivation and resilience, making you more willing to take risks and persevere through challenges. It enables you to see setbacks not as failures, but as opportunities for growth and learning. This positive mindset is crucial for achieving your goals and reaching your full potential. Moreover, self-confidence plays a significant role in your overall well-being. When you feel good about yourself, you're less likely to be plagued by anxiety, stress, and self-doubt. This can lead to improved mental health, stronger relationships, and a greater sense of happiness and fulfillment. People who are self-confident tend to have a more optimistic outlook on life, which can help them cope with difficult situations and bounce back from adversity. In the workplace, self-confidence can open doors to new opportunities and career advancement. Employers are often drawn to individuals who exude confidence, as they are seen as more capable, decisive, and effective leaders. Self-assured individuals are also more likely to negotiate for better salaries and promotions, and they are better equipped to handle high-pressure situations. Furthermore, self-confidence enhances your communication skills. When you believe in yourself, you are more likely to express your ideas clearly and persuasively, and you are less afraid to speak up in meetings or presentations. This can lead to greater influence and respect among your peers and colleagues. Ultimately, self-confidence empowers you to live a more authentic and fulfilling life. It allows you to embrace your unique qualities, pursue your passions, and make a positive impact on the world. So, if you want to unlock your full potential and live your best life, start by building your self-confidence today!
